Home
last modified time | relevance | path

Searched refs:buffer (Results 1 – 6 of 6) sorted by relevance

/dalvik/tools/dexdeps/src/com/android/dexdeps/
DDexData.java112 ByteBuffer buffer = readByteBuffer(Integer.BYTES * 20); in parseHeaderItem() local
113 mHeaderItem.fileSize = buffer.getInt(); in parseHeaderItem()
114 mHeaderItem.headerSize = buffer.getInt(); in parseHeaderItem()
115 /*mHeaderItem.endianTag =*/ buffer.getInt(); in parseHeaderItem()
116 /*mHeaderItem.linkSize =*/ buffer.getInt(); in parseHeaderItem()
117 /*mHeaderItem.linkOff =*/ buffer.getInt(); in parseHeaderItem()
118 /*mHeaderItem.mapOff =*/ buffer.getInt(); in parseHeaderItem()
119 mHeaderItem.stringIdsSize = buffer.getInt(); in parseHeaderItem()
120 mHeaderItem.stringIdsOff = buffer.getInt(); in parseHeaderItem()
121 mHeaderItem.typeIdsSize = buffer.getInt(); in parseHeaderItem()
[all …]
/dalvik/dx/src/com/android/dex/
DClassDef.java24 private final Dex buffer; field in ClassDef
35 public ClassDef(Dex buffer, int offset, int typeIndex, int accessFlags, in ClassDef() argument
38 this.buffer = buffer; in ClassDef()
67 return buffer.readTypeList(interfacesOffset).getTypes(); in getInterfaces()
92 if (buffer == null) { in toString()
97 result.append(buffer.typeNames().get(typeIndex)); in toString()
99 result.append(" extends ").append(buffer.typeNames().get(supertypeIndex)); in toString()
DDex.java132 byte[] buffer = new byte[8192]; in loadFrom()
135 while ((count = in.read(buffer)) != -1) { in loadFrom()
136 bytesOut.write(buffer, 0, count); in loadFrom()
151 byte[] buffer = new byte[8192]; in writeTo()
155 int count = Math.min(buffer.length, data.remaining()); in writeTo()
156 data.get(buffer, 0, count); in writeTo()
157 out.write(buffer, 0, count); in writeTo()
279 byte[] buffer = new byte[8192]; in computeSignature()
284 int count = Math.min(buffer.length, data.remaining()); in computeSignature()
285 data.get(buffer, 0, count); in computeSignature()
[all …]
/dalvik/dx/junit-tests/com/android/dx/merge/
DDexMergerTest.java84 byte[] buffer = new byte[8192]; in readEntireStream()
87 while ((count = inputStream.read(buffer)) != -1) { in readEntireStream()
88 bytesOut.write(buffer, 0, count); in readEntireStream()
/dalvik/dx/tests/115-merge/com/android/dx/merge/
DDexMergeTest.java191 byte[] buffer = new byte[1024]; in copy()
193 while ((count = in.read(buffer)) != -1) { in copy()
194 out.write(buffer, 0, count); in copy()
/dalvik/dx/src/com/android/dx/merge/
DDexMerger.java650 private void readSortableTypes(SortableType[] sortableTypes, Dex buffer, in readSortableTypes() argument
652 for (ClassDef classDef : buffer.classDefs()) { in readSortableTypes()
654 new SortableType(buffer, indexMap, classDef)); in readSortableTypes()
660 + buffer.typeNames().get(classDef.getTypeIndex())); in readSortableTypes()